Analysis

In 2024, sugar crops primary — yield, annual growth rate in Australia and New Zealand stood at -11.11 % change on previous year.

That represents a change of down 171.4% on the previous year and down 755.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sugar crops primary — yield, annual growth rate in Australia and New Zealand peaked at 35.87 % change on previous year in 1993 and was at its lowest, -23.46 % change on previous year, in 2001.

Australia and New Zealand ranks 135th of 154 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
